About the role

What will you do at CSC Generation?

CSC Generation is building closed-loop decision systems that use machine learning to operate consumer businesses more intelligently.

We are starting with pricing and expanding into areas such as inventory, purchasing, promotions, marketing, and assortment.

The Role

You will help build systems that:

**estimate causal response + quantify uncertainty → choose actions → generate useful information → observe outcomes → update policies → evaluate challengers → deploy within guardrails**

We want to answer questions such as:

- What happens **because we change a price**, rather than simply what happens next?

- How should uncertainty affect a decision?

- When should the system exploit what it knows versus experiment to learn?

- Can we estimate the value of a challenger policy before fully deploying it?

- How do we optimize economic outcomes while respecting inventory, margin, vendor, customer, and operational constraints?

What You’ll Work On

Depending on your background, you may work across:

- causal and heterogeneous treatment-effect modeling;

- uncertainty estimation and calibration;

- contextual bandits, active learning, or sequential decision-making;

- policy learning and constrained optimization;

- counterfactual and off-policy evaluation;

- experimentation and champion/challenger systems;

- production ML infrastructure, monitoring, and automated deployment.

We care about selecting the right method, not using a particular framework.

What Success Looks Like

Success is not a better offline metric.

The systems you build should produce measurable economic lift in controlled experiments, generalize across businesses, learn from their own interventions, and safely automate an increasing share of real commercial decisions.

Over time, the goal is simple:

**the system should become better at operating the business because it has operated the business. **

  • Why This Role Is Different
  • Most ML systems learn from a dataset.
  • Here, **the decisions made by the model influence the data the model sees next**.
  • That creates a continuous loop:
  • **Decision → intervention → outcome → learning → better decision**
  • The long-term opportunity is to build that capability once and apply it across a portfolio of businesses and increasingly broad commercial decisions.
